PEG226KH4150QE4 by KEMET Corporation

PEG226KH4150QE4 by KEMET is a 1500uF aluminum electrolytic capacitor with 40V URdc. It features a leakage current of 0.184mA, ripple current of 2275mA, and ESR of 57mohm. Ideal for applications requiring high capacitance and reliability in automotive electronics meeting AEC-Q200 standards.

Feature Benefit Bullets

Dielectric Material: ALUMINUM (WET)

Aluminum electrolytic capacitors are known for their high capacitance values and low ESR, making them suitable for applications requiring high levels of capacitance and low cost.

Leakage Current (mA): 0.184

Low leakage current ensures the capacitor retains its charge for longer periods, making it ideal for applications where energy storage is required.

Ripple Current (mA): 2275

High ripple current handling capability allows the capacitor to smooth out fluctuations in power supply, ensuring stable operation in demanding applications.

Package Style (Meter): Axial

Axial package style provides easy through-hole mounting and stable mechanical support, making it suitable for applications where reliability is important.

Capacitance: 1500 uF

High capacitance value of 1500 uF allows the capacitor to store large amounts of energy, making it suitable for power supply and filtering applications.

Manufacturer Highlights

KEMET Corporation

KEMET Corporation is an American electronics company that specializes in the design, manufacturing, and distribution of capacitors, electromagnetic compatibility solutions, and other electronic components. The company was founded in 1919 and is headquartered in Fort Lauderdale, Florida, with manufacturing facilities and sales offices around the world. KEMET Corporation and its subsidiaries (KEMET), is a wholly owned subsidiary of Yageo Corporation (TAIEX: 2327).
